L. Tribe et A. Batana, EFFECTIVE CHARGE AT HIGH-PRESSURE IN FLUORITE STRUCTURED IONIC-CRYSTALS, Anales de la Asociacion Quimica Argentina, 82(5), 1994, pp. 391-398
In high pressure studies of ionic crystals it is important to have the
value of the effective charge and its variation with pressure. This m
agnitude may be obtained directly from Sziget's generalized equation,
with the restriction that experimental data of various magnitudes at h
igh pressure are required and are not always available. In the present
work values are proposed of the variation of the effective charge wit
h volume, calculated with an alterantive formalism (Hardy's Model), fo
r ionic crystals of the fluorite structure. These results are compared
with partial derivative lns/partial derivative lnv values obtained fr
om a Shell Model with a formalism developed here.
